[ALSA] hda-codec - Add support of HP Thin Client T5735

Added the support of HP Thin Client T5735 [0x103c 0x302f] with ALC262 codec.

+static struct hda_bind_ctls alc262_hp_t5735_bind_front_vol = {
+       .ops = &snd_hda_bind_vol,
+       .values = {
+               HDA_COMPOSE_AMP_VAL(0x0c, 3, 0, HDA_OUTPUT),
+               HDA_COMPOSE_AMP_VAL(0x0d, 3, 0, HDA_OUTPUT),
+               0
+       },
+};
+
+static struct hda_bind_ctls alc262_hp_t5735_bind_front_sw = {
+       .ops = &snd_hda_bind_sw,
+       .values = {
+               HDA_COMPOSE_AMP_VAL(0x14, 3, 0, HDA_OUTPUT),
+               HDA_COMPOSE_AMP_VAL(0x15, 3, 0, HDA_OUTPUT),
+               0
+       },
+};
+
+/* mute/unmute internal speaker according to the hp jack and mute state */
+static void alc262_hp_t5735_automute(struct hda_codec *codec, int force)
+{
+       struct alc_spec *spec = codec->spec;
+       unsigned int mute;
+
+       if (force || !spec->sense_updated) {
+               unsigned int present;
+               present = snd_hda_codec_read(codec, 0x15, 0,
+                                            AC_VERB_GET_PIN_SENSE, 0);
+               spec->jack_present = (present & 0x80000000) != 0;
+               spec->sense_updated = 1;
+       }
+       if (spec->jack_present)
+               mute = (0x7080 | ((0)<<8));  /* mute internal speaker */
+       else    /* unmute internal speaker if necessary */
+               mute = (0x7000 | ((0)<<8));
+               snd_hda_codec_write(codec, 0x0c, 0,
+                           AC_VERB_SET_AMP_GAIN_MUTE, mute );
+}
+
+static void alc262_hp_t5735_unsol_event(struct hda_codec *codec,
+                                       unsigned int res)
+{
+       if ((res >> 26) != ALC880_HP_EVENT)
+               return;
+       alc262_hp_t5735_automute(codec, 1);
+}
+
+static void alc262_hp_t5735_init_hook(struct hda_codec *codec)
+{
+       alc262_hp_t5735_automute(codec, 1);
+}
+
+static struct snd_kcontrol_new alc262_hp_t5735_mixer[] = {
+       HDA_BIND_VOL("PCM Playback Volume", &alc262_hp_t5735_bind_front_vol),
+       HDA_BIND_SW("PCM Playback Switch",&alc262_hp_t5735_bind_front_sw),
+       HDA_CODEC_VOLUME("LineOut Playback Volume", 0x0c, 0x0, HDA_OUTPUT),
+       HDA_CODEC_MUTE("LineOut Playback Switch", 0x14, 0x0, HDA_OUTPUT),
+       HDA_CODEC_VOLUME("iSpeaker Playback Volume", 0x0c, 0x0, HDA_OUTPUT),
+       HDA_CODEC_MUTE("iSpeaker Playback Switch", 0x14, 0x0, HDA_OUTPUT),
+       HDA_CODEC_VOLUME("Headphone Playback Volume", 0x0d, 0x0, HDA_OUTPUT),
+       HDA_CODEC_MUTE("Headphone Playback Switch", 0x15, 0x0, HDA_OUTPUT),
+       HDA_CODEC_VOLUME("Mic Playback Volume", 0x0b, 0x0, HDA_INPUT),
+       HDA_CODEC_MUTE("Mic Playback Switch", 0x0b, 0x0, HDA_INPUT),
+       HDA_CODEC_VOLUME("Mic Boost", 0x18, 0, HDA_INPUT),
+       { } /* end */
+};
+
+static struct hda_verb alc262_hp_t5735_verbs[] = {
+       {0x14, AC_VERB_SET_PIN_WIDGET_CONTROL, PIN_OUT},
+       {0x15, AC_VERB_SET_PIN_WIDGET_CONTROL, PIN_HP},
+
+       {0x15, AC_VERB_SET_UNSOLICITED_ENABLE, ALC880_HP_EVENT | AC_USRSP_EN},
+       { }
+};
